Sensors measure the brightness and detect the presence of persons. The lighting conditions at the workplace are maintained at a user-adjustable set point by providing artificial light according to the amount of available daylight. If there is enough natural daylight or if there are no persons in the room, the lighting control unit switches off the luminaire. Brightness control and detection can be activated or deactivated. Good workplace lighting makes the working environment more comfortable. Energy savings of up to 70% can be made compared with conventional workplace lighting. The lighting control unit is available in the following versions: DALI MULTI 3 can be installed in luminaires (e.g. floor-standing luminaires) or can be installed in recessed ceilings using the LMS CI BOX mounting kit (e.g. for room lighting systems), see appendix. Wiring diagram Max. number of ECG see technical data in the appendix Installation of the light and sensor The sensor is connected using the supplied sensor cable. If the cable is shortened or lengthened (up to 100 m), ensure 1:1 wiring. If several sensors are to be connected the contact of one sensor can be doubled via an Y-connector. The second contact of the Y-connector is used as the connection for the next sensor. In this way, up to 4 sensors can be connected in parallel to the DALI MULTI 3. A sensor has a detection angle of approx. 80-100. If it is installed at a height of 3 m, it can monitor an area with a maximum diameter of 5-7 m. If more than one sensor is used the detection area can be enlarged or made more densely monitored. When installing the sensor, please note the following: The entire workplace must lie within the monitoring cone of the sensor. Avoid placing the sensor where it is directly exposed to light from other sources as this will lead to incorrect measurements. The sensor must not be exposed to draught (e.g. near air vents). A draught could be misinterpreted as the presence of a person in the room. OSRAM operating instructions: DALI MULTI 3 Page 3 With the luminaire switched on: 1. Press the switch. Controlling brightness at the workplace Switching the luminaire on and off ally* If natural daylight is enough as a light source, the lighting control unit will switch the luminaire off. The luminaire will be switched off with a delay of approx. 1.5 minutes. If the light value at the workplace falls below the set point value and if persons are present the lighting control unit will switch the luminaire back on and control the brightness. Motion detector Switching the luminaire on and off ally* If the detector does not detect movement for 15 minutes, the lighting control unit will reduce the brightness level to the minimum value and then switch the luminaire off. As soon as is detected the luminaire will be switched on, provided artificial light is needed. Switching off at the switch, switching on via detection* If the luminaire has been switched off manually, the luminaire cannot be switched on ally via the detector until an interval of 30 seconds has elapsed. At the end of this interval the next detected will switch on the luminaire, provided artificial light is needed. Holiday mode* Automatic switching of the luminaire via the detector can be deactivated if the room is to be empty for some time. The brightness must not be changed manually at least 30 seconds before holiday mode can be activated. 1. Briefly press the switch twice The brightness is reduced to a minimum and the luminaire is then switched off. Motion detection is deactivated until the luminaire is next switched on at the switch. modes Daylight dependent and detection control may be activated and deactivated individually. The as-delivered condition is now restored (the proper RESET is confirmed by ten additional flashes after the switch is released). Troubleshooting The luminaire is not working. Possible cause: There is no power. The lamps are faulty. Replace them. The luminaire was switched off at the switch. Switch the luminaire on. The sensor is overexposed to ambient light. Cover the sensor and observe how the luminaire behaves. The luminaire is not regulating its brightness to the set point value. Possible cause: Within 30 seconds after setting the brightness you must press the switch twice briefly. If you press the switch later you will activate holiday mode. Bear this time in mind. Brightness control is started 5 seconds after the set point value has been set. Within this time any other switch operations are ignored. Bear this time in mind. Brightness control was deactivated by changing the brightness level with the switch. Switch the luminaire off and on again. Brightness control is not active in the activated operation mode. The luminaire is not switched on ally by the detector. Possible cause: The luminaire was switched off less than 30 seconds ago at the switch. Please note: after the luminaire is switched off, detection is deactivated for 30 seconds. The detector is not covering the workplace. Wave your hand in front of the sensor and observe how the luminaire behaves. The LED of the sensor should flash with each detected. If not, realign the luminaire over the workplace. Adequate natural daylight is available and no additional artificial light is needed. The holiday mode is active. For deactivation of the holiday mode please press the switch Motion detection is not active in the activated operation mode. Holiday mode can not be activated. Possible cause: The brightness level was changed at the switch less than 30 seconds ago. Wait at least 30 seconds after changing the brightness before activating holiday mode. The set point can not be stored. Possible cause: The set point storage is locked. Brightness regulation is not supported by the selected operation mode. The luminaire is not reacting as expected to switch operations. Possible cause: The switch is being pressed too long. Please note: Hold down the switch to change the brightness until the luminaire reaches the brightness level you want. For all other functions, just briefly press the switch. If you cannot remedy the problem, please reset the luminaire as described in the corresponding chapter of this manual or contact the customer service department of your luminaire manufacturer.
